摘要
The first long wavelength quantum well infrared photodetector based on valence band intersubband absorption holes is demonstrated. A normal incidence quantum efficiency of eta = 28% and detectivity of D-lambda* = 3.1 x 10(10) cm square-root Hz/W at T = 77 K, for a cutoff wavelength lambda-c = 7.9-mu-m, have been achieved.
